OLIVIA Curtain had an amazing win at the Australian Showjumping Championship’s at Sydney International Equestrian Centre.
The 12-year-old jumper won first for the Junior (under 18) Opal Series at 1.05 metres.
The Australian Championships is the pinnacle of showjumping in Australia and after coming third last year to then win it this year on her very talented gelding Indi’s Mr Zorba Jones has just topped off what has been a terrific year for Olivia and her ponies.
The training behind the scenes and dedication that Olivia exerts on a daily basis for a 12-year-old athlete is second to none and is testament to her results.
Olivia and her ponies have had a big year travelling over 20,000 kilometres to show’s over the past 12 months with the Victorian State Titles the next big show next weekend.
